Since Congress beefed up whistle-blower rewards in late 2006, tips about suspected tax cheats owing at least $2 million have jumped more than tenfold, the Internal Revenue Service said.

In 2008, the agency received tips on 1,246 suspected tax dodgers, each owing more than $2 million. That’s up from 116 big-money tips in 2007.
